Getting Started
Welcome to a different PDF reader! Highlights extracts the
text and images you markup and formats them into notes
on the fly. It will also extract annotations from your existing
PDFs when you open them.

Let’s go through the basics of using the app starting with


the interface. The Toolbar is located at the top and can be
hidden by a single tap on the document. To show it again
tap the document once more.

On a compact screen, like an iPhone or the app in Slide


Over on an iPad, the toolbar will have limited space and
some options will be tucked away under the More button.

The Display Settings lets you switch between the PDF and
your Notes. On wider screens you have the additional
option of showing Both PDF and Notes side-by-side.
Rotating the screen will automatically change this setting.

On the bottom bar you will find the thumbnail view that lets
you scrub through the PDF by dragging your finger over it:

To close a PDF and go back to your files, tap the back


arrow in the top left corner.
Annotate Faster
To annotate a PDF you select the content with your finger
and use the popover to specify the markup type:

If you use an iPad with an Apple Pencil, you can enable the
Annotation Bar in the toolbar and select the tool there
before making the selection.
Apple Pencil and mouse pointer users also have access to
color options in the text selection popover when annotating.

To annotate even faster, enable default annotation colors. PRO

To change an existing annotation or add a comment, tap the


annotation to bring up the annotation popover:

Made for Research
Extracting text is just the beginning. Highlights can extract a
range of information and is optimized for scientific articles.

Image Selection: grabs an image of the current


selection in the PDF.

Text Recognition: OCR a selection to extract PRO


text from PDFs without a working text layer.

Table Recognition: Convert image selections to PRO


tables with actual data using machine learning.

Fetch metadata: Automatically detect DOI-links in PRO


scientific literature and download the metadata.

Citation lookup: Markup the text of a citation and PRO


tap the link icon in the Annotation Popover.

Export Anywhere
Tap the Share icon in the top right corner
to share your Notes or the PDF itself.

Notes can be exported anywhere as PDF


files in the free version.

As a Pro user, you can export your notes


to editable formats such as Markdown,
TextBundle and HTML. You can also

Customize the appearance of your notes


using the Format options. Here you can
decide what to include in your Notes.

Sort your annotations by color lets you


use your own color categories and
sorting order for your annotations.

Copy the contents of an annotation using


the copy button in the popover. Or using
the three finger tap gesture.

Smart Copy gives you the


PRO desired format depending on the
context.

Copying an image selection will


paste a PNG, a citation a BibTex
string and a table a CSV that can
be imported into a spreadsheet.
